  • Hi there galeroy. Thanks for the feedback, and apologies to hear you’re having issues. It sounds like what you’re experiencing is a set-up issue…in theory, and on all the sites we’ve tested on / users have provided feedback on, the installation is just a process of uploading the folder, activating the plugin and going from there.

    The calendar does not live on the homepage of the site; it lives at /events (or whatever you configured under The Events Calendar –> Settings). You shouldn’t have to add any code to make this happen. Perhaps that was where you ran into an issue?
